CASE STUDY 01

Financial Services Target Architecture

Timeline: Estimated 14-Week Architectural Lifecycle

Client Challenge

A financial institution faced severe response latency and data reconciliation mismatches in their core retail banking API layer. Their legacy system failed to scale during peak trading periods, causing transaction queue blockages.

System Architecture

Multi-region AWS setup using an event-driven pattern with Kafka streaming, Redis clustering for cache resolution, and PostgreSQL running with scoped Row-Level Security (RLS) policies. Deployed behind an isolated API Gateway layer with strict mTLS authentication.

Solution Implemented

We decoupled their legacy monolithic services into isolated Go-based microservices, implemented transactional queuing schemas to prevent double-charging risks, and built a real-time CDC (Change Data Capture) database sync pipeline.

CASE STUDY 02

Healthcare Integration Illustrative Example

Timeline: Estimated 16-Week Design Lifecycle

Client Challenge

A medical provider was unable to share patient diagnostic histories across clinical centers due to HIPAA compliance routing issues, legacy HL7 database silos, and lack of real-time sync capabilities, causing care delivery delays.

System Architecture

Isolated Next.js customer portals with HIPAA-compliant AWS ECS compute clusters, encrypted database storage (AES-256 at-rest), and a custom FHIR API routing gateway. Auditable access trails were managed using decentralized logging modules.

Solution Implemented

Created a secure, real-time diagnostic orchestrator matching patients to diagnostic reports. Integrated HL7 data translation engines and built passwordless identity portals for practitioners using encrypted context validators.

CASE STUDY 03

Logistics Automation Sample Workflow

Timeline: Estimated 10-Week Integration Design Lifecycle

Client Challenge

A supply chain provider operating across multiple regions struggled with manual customs dispatch document ingestion. Operational staff spent thousands of hours annually validating manifest templates, causing port storage fines.

System Architecture

AI-native parsing pipeline utilizing proprietary RAG vector indexes, Azure Document Intelligence, dynamic routing models, and automated fallback gates requiring manual human-in-the-loop (HITL) clearance for validation failures.

Solution Implemented

Deployed a custom document intelligence portal that ingests multi-format PDFs, extracts customs line-items with high accuracy, matches them against regional tariff databases, and triggers automated customs submission APIs.
